Engineering Physics is offered at a wide range of schools across the country, but only at some does it account for a large share of the degrees the school grants. To top this list, a school awards a larger share of its degrees in engineering physics than other colleges that offer the major.

To build this ranking, College Factual compared the degree focus of the 48 schools in the United States offering engineering physics.

Notes and References

This list is compiled by College Factual. The ranking reflects how concentrated each school’s degrees are in the major (completions in the field as a share of all completions), drawn from the U.S. Department of Education (IPEDS).
